About The Author
Sheila Grant worked for CBS broadcasting in the late 1960s in the programming department under the legendary television executive Michael Dann, where she was a writer and analyst specializing in US/Soviet relations at the height of the Cold War. She attended Southern Methodist University in Dallas and The University of Texas at Austin where she studied English literature. She also attended the University of Mexico and the American Institute in Mexico City where she lived with Chela del Río, sister of famed actress Dolores del Río. It was Chela del Río who introduced her to the Mexico that became the backdrop of Passport to Danger. Grant is a bibliophile who devours Publisher’s Weekly and visits the nearest bookstore every Tuesday to purchase the new releases. Grant is a native of Dallas where she resides with her husband, Jody, with whom she has two adult children.
